The Invention of Hugo Cabret made me reconsider what a book can be. A novel told through words and pictures, it tells the story of an orphan living secretly inside the walls of a Paris train station and the mystery he is desperate to solve. Selznick's pencil illustrations unspool in long, wordless sequences that feel like watching a film. I love to gift it to kids ages nine and older, when children are ready to be swept away by something different and ambitious. It's a book they'll never forget.
